Docker Desktop企业部署指南:macOS PKG安装与配置详解
【免费下载链接】docs Source repo for Docker's Documentation 项目地址: https://gitcode.com/gh_mirrors/docs3/docs
前言
在企业环境中,标准化软件部署是IT管理的重要环节。Docker Desktop作为开发者的核心工具,其企业级部署需要满足集中管理、安全合规等要求。本文将详细介绍如何使用PKG安装包在macOS系统上进行Docker Desktop的企业级部署。
PKG安装包的优势
PKG格式是macOS的标准软件包格式,特别适合企业环境部署,主要优势包括:
- 批量部署能力:支持通过MDM(移动设备管理)解决方案进行大规模部署
- 标准化安装:确保所有终端设备安装配置一致
- 策略控制:可配置安装参数,满足企业安全策略
- 版本控制:禁用自动更新,便于企业统一管理版本
交互式安装步骤
准备工作
在开始安装前,请确保:
- 您拥有组织管理员权限
- 目标Mac设备满足Docker Desktop系统要求
- 设备已连接互联网
详细安装流程
-
获取安装包
- 登录Docker管理控制台
- 导航至组织下的Docker Desktop部署页面
- 在macOS选项卡中下载PKG安装包
-
运行安装向导
- 双击下载的
Docker.pkg文件 - 按照向导步骤操作:
- 简介页面:点击"继续"
- 许可协议:阅读后点击"同意"
- 目标选择:建议保持默认安装位置(通常为Macintosh HD)
- 安装类型:点击"安装"
- 认证:输入管理员密码或使用Touch ID验证
- 完成:安装完成后点击"关闭"
- 双击下载的
重要注意事项
- PKG安装方式会自动禁用应用内更新功能,这是企业管理的必要特性
- 当有新版本发布时,Docker Desktop会显示更新通知
- 更新需通过重新下载安装包完成,确保版本控制
命令行安装方法
对于需要自动化部署的场景,可通过终端命令完成安装:
sudo installer -pkg "/path/to/Docker.pkg" -target /Applications
此方法特别适合:
- 自动化部署脚本
- CI/CD流程集成
- 远程设备管理
企业级配置建议
版本管理策略
- 建立内部版本审批流程
- 定期检查Docker Desktop更新
- 在测试环境验证新版本后再部署
安全配置
- 强制执行登录认证
- 配置适当的资源限制
- 设置网络访问策略
常见问题解答
Q:PKG安装和DMG安装有何区别? A:PKG专为企业部署设计,支持批量安装和策略控制,而DMG更适合个人开发者使用。
Q:如何确认安装是否成功? A:可检查应用程序目录是否存在Docker应用,或运行docker --version命令验证。
Q:企业如何管理多版本共存? A:建议通过MDM工具统一管理,确保组织内使用相同版本。
总结
通过PKG安装包部署Docker Desktop是企业IT管理的理想选择。本文详细介绍了从获取安装包到完成部署的全过程,包括交互式和命令行两种安装方式。企业管理员应根据组织需求,制定适当的部署策略和版本管理方案,确保开发环境的稳定性和安全性。
【免费下载链接】docs Source repo for Docker's Documentation 项目地址: https://gitcode.com/gh_mirrors/docs3/docs
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



